Larry Fink Compensation Structure at BlackRock
Base Salary and Annual Bonus
Fink’s base salary is modest relative to total compensation, designed to align with long term stewardship rather than short term payouts. Annual bonuses reward firmwide performance, risk controls, and client retention metrics reviewed by BlackRock’s compensation committee.
Equity Grants and Share Ownership
Significant portions of Fink’s net worth stem from BlackRock equity grants, including stock awards and share appreciation rights. These holdings tie his wealth closely to shareholder returns, governance outcomes, and long term value creation.
Deferred Compensation and Pension Benefits
Deferred compensation plans and executive pension arrangements add to Fink’s overall earnings profile, balancing current income with future payouts. These mechanisms reflect retention strategies common among global investment managers.
BlackRock Growth and Industry Position
AUM Expansion and Market Leadership
Under Fink’s leadership, BlackRock expanded assets under management into multiple trillions of dollars across investment vehicles. Exchange traded funds (iShares) became a core engine, strengthening BlackRock’s competitive moat.
ESG Leadership and Influence
Fink’s emphasis on environmental, social, and governance factors repositioned BlackRock as a central voice in corporate policy debates. This focus attracted institutional clients and influenced board level expectations for disclosures.
Strategic Acquisitions and Partnerships
Key acquisitions and technology partnerships accelerated BlackRock’s data and analytics capabilities. These moves supported risk management tools, client solutions, and differentiated research offerings.
